Clash 是一个功能强大的流量转发工具,但在使用过程中,许多用户发现局域网(proxy) 代理存在无法正常使用的情况。本文将从多个层面分析为什么 Clash 的局域网代理不能使用,并提供相关的解决方案。
什么是Clash局域网代理
在深入探讨之前,首先我们需要明确“Clash局域网代理”指的是什么。Clash 是一款使用 Go 语言开发的代理工具,它能够支持不同类型的代理协议,比如 SOCKS5、HTTP 等。在局域网内,Clash 代理可以通过把网络流量转发到不同的目标地址,来实现上网行为的隐蔽和安全。
为什么选择 Clach 作局域网代理
- 简化操作:通过图形界面可以比较直观地配置不同的代理。
- 灵活性:支持众多协议,可根据需求自行配置。
- 功能强大:能够实时监控网络流量和代理状态。
各类出现的问题
通常,Clash 局域网代理不能使用的原因比较复杂。以下列出了一些常见问题。
1. 网络配置不当
- IP 地址配置错误:确保 Clash 配置文件中 Ubuntu 的局域网 IP 地址正确,且在局域网内可以被访问到。
- 端口冲突:检查 Clash 在本地监听的端口是否与其他程序的端口冲突。
2. 防火墙或安全软件阻止
- 确保防火墙设置允许 Clash 允许的连接,很多情况下,安全软件自动阻止关联流量。
3. Clash 版本问题
- 运行较旧版本的 Clash 可能无法正常支持局域网代理特性,确保使用的是最新版本。
4. 配置文件错误
- YAML 格式问题:配置文件的格式要求严格,确保没有错误因素存在,导致事件链条终止。
Clah局域网代理的解决方案
下面将分别提供如何解决上述层面的问题。
网络配置不当解决方案
- 检验本地IP:插入命令行执行
ip a
查看本地 IP 地址相关信息并修正 Clah 单元文件中的地址。 - 压力测试监听端口:通过
netstat -tlnp
命令来确定 Clash 监听端口是否可以连接。
防火墙及安全软件问题解决方案
- 检查防火墙设置:在终端输入
sudo ufw status
并确保你的配置允许 TCP 1880(或其他端口)流量通过。 - 调试安全软件:试着暂时停用任何安全软件,看访问局域网代理工具是否恢复。
升级或重新配置Clash解决方案
- 访问 ∙ GitHub ∙ 下载最新版本并按照指引进行手动更新。
- 检查配置文件,使用经典手动挂载策略,避免 YAML 序列及 Succession 错误。
FAQ:常见问题解答
Clash 教程哪里学?
- 你可以访问官方网站或许多еда「YouTube」关于 Clash 的详细解说、解析和教学视频。
合并丢失的配置文件问题怎么办?
- 如果丢失文件而不知后果,则检查系统 /etc/clash/ (Unix), 修改以及回滚。
使用 Clash 代理安全吗?
- Clash 本身没有涉及隐私数据窃取的问题,但它是 开放源代码,你要确保从可信的渠道获得 WHS。
如何查看 Clash 日志以调试?
- 在 Clash 的配置设定选项中,根据 UI 注释添加
loglevel: debug
。
总结
Clash 局域网代理在大多数情况下是非常实用的工具,通过此文你应该能够识别到自已当前设置的问题所在,并寻找合适方案解决它。总之,有问题不可怕,通过调整位置信息、端口配置以及界面调理,局域网常见问题就能识别与消除,让ષ્ટClash成监控的智慧助手!
正文完